Why these dates

Plant out two weeks after last frost, once nights are reliably above 12C. A second sowing in midsummer replaces plants that have gone to flower.

Damaged at 1C, before any actual frost forms. If your forecast shows 2C, basil should already be indoors.

Seed packets and extension guides express timing as weeks either side of the last spring frost, because that is the only reference point that travels. Basil are timed from 4 weeks before that frost for an indoor start, with planting out 2 weeks after it, and this page simply resolves those offsets against the frost date computed for Phnom Penh.
